Asset NAV is the value of the company s assets which in mining is its mines This is calculated by projecting each mine s after tax cash flows discounting it by an appropriate discount rate 5 10% for precious metals then summing its cash flows to arrive at a present value AKA NPV or NAV This is a DCF but the components of it are

Get PriceThis process had been patented by Miller Assayer of the Sydney Mint in 1867 and used in Australia since 1872 in contrast to the Lon don and continental refineries which were still using the sulphuric acid par ting process On 27 November 1920 Rand Refinery Limited was registered as a private company with initial capital of £50000 raised from shares limited to gold mining

Get PriceAt a pH below essentially all dissolved cyanide is present as HCN Most mining process solutions such as tailings solutions or leach solutions are kept at alkaline pH levels April 2024 European Commission EUROSTAT Information Hub Impacts of Gold Extraction in the EU 7 because metal extraction is more efficient at these levels This prevents the formation of poisonous HCN gas 4

Get PriceBarlow did some research and found that gold had been mined in and around Buckingham for about 30 years back in the 19th century ending in 1849 when the gold rush in California drew off all the miners Mining then was accomplished with picks and shovels Old gold pits mostly overgrown still dot the landscape

Get PriceThe stages that contributed the most to gold s environmental impact were mining and comminution crushing and grinding of the ore Electricity use was responsible for just over half of the GHG emissions This indicates that attempts to lessen the environmental impact of gold production should focus on these two stages Mining and comminution are highly dependent on the grade of gold ore as

Get PriceThe Zimbabwe mining legacy dates back to medieval Great Zimbabwe The Munhumutapa Empire had command over and exploited not less than 4 000 gold and 500 copper mines spread across the country The milling and purification of gold and copper was carried out close to the extraction sites
